Experimental investigation on detonation initiation with a transversal flame jet

Abstract: This paper reports on an investigation of detonation initiation with a transversal flame jet. Series of single-cycle experiments are performed, where stoichiometric propane–oxygen mixtures with nitrogen dilution at atmospheric initial pressure are used, both in the flame sub-chamber with varying configurations and in the test tube 70 mm in diameter and 1550 mm long. The experimental results show that the flame jet orifice diameter slightly affects the detonation initiation sensitivity, and the flame sub-chamber configurations exert a minor effect on the deflagration-to-detonation transition (DDT) distance, but the DDT time decreases as the flame sub-chamber length increases. Conventional spark ignition is investigated as a comparison experiment, and detonation initiation is not observed in mixtures with nitrogen dilution up to 65%.
